• |
Sales of Real Estate: The Wind-Down Group is in the process of marketing and selling its real estate assets, all of which are held for sale. One single-family home and one other real estate asset was
listed for sale as of September 30, 2022. As of September 30, 2022, the Company owned a total of five real estate assets with a gross carrying value of approximately $30.96 million. The majority of the gross carrying value is concentrated
in one single-family home. Based on the remaining assets of the Company, future net proceeds will be significantly less than the Company has realized in prior periods.
|
• |
Escrow Receivables: As of September 30, 2022, the Wind-Down Group had escrow receivables relating to two single-family homes that had been sold and for which it was completing punch list items and/or
awaiting the issuance of a certificate of occupancy.
|
• |
Causes of Action Recoveries: During the three months ended September 30, 2022, the Company recognized approximately $0.19 million from the settlement of Causes of Action. There can be no assurance that
the amounts the Company recovers from settling Causes of Action in the future will be consistent with the amount recovered in prior periods.
|
PART I. FINANCIAL INFORMATION (CONTINUED)
|
Item 2. Management’s Discussion and Analysis of Financial Condition and Results of Operations (Continued)
|
• |
Forfeited Assets: Forfeited Assets consist of cash and other assets (jewelry, art, clothing, handbags and shoes). During the three months ended September 30, 2022, the Trust sold some of its Forfeited
Assets and received net proceeds of approximately $0.58 million. As noted earlier, net sale proceeds from liquidating the Forfeited Assets are to be distributed only to Qualifying Victims.

o |
Preferential transfers. Certain of the actions include claims arising under chapter 5 of the Bankruptcy Code and seek to avoid or recover payments made by the Debtors
during the 90 days prior to the December 4, 2017 bankruptcy filing, including payments to miscellaneous vendors and former Noteholders and Unitholders.
|
o |
Fraudulent transfers (Interest to Noteholders and Unitholders). Certain of the actions include claims arising under chapter 5 of the Bankruptcy Code and seek to avoid or
recover payments made by the Debtors during the course of the Ponzi scheme (from July 2012 through the December 4, 2017 bankruptcy filing) for interest paid to former Noteholders and Unitholders.
|
o |
Fraudulent transfers (Shapiro personal expenses). Certain of the actions include claims arising under chapter 5 of the Bankruptcy Code and seek to avoid and recover
payments made by the Debtors during the course of the Ponzi scheme (from July 2012 through the December 4, 2017 bankruptcy filing) for the personal expenses of Robert and Jeri Shapiro, including those identified in a forensic report
prepared in connection with an SEC enforcement action in the United States District Court for the Southern District of Florida.
|
o |
Fraudulent transfers and fraud (against former agents). These actions, which arise under chapter 5 of the Bankruptcy Code and applicable state law governing fraudulent
transfers, seek to avoid and recover payments made by the Debtors during the course of the Ponzi scheme (from July 2012 through the December 4, 2017 bankruptcy filing) for commissions to former agents, as well as for fraud, aiding and
abetting fraud, and the unlicensed sale of securities asserted by the Trust based on claims contributed to the Trust by defrauded investors. These actions were filed by the Trust in the United States Bankruptcy Court for the District of
Delaware between November 15, 2019 and December 4, 2019. Actions of this type are also being pursued by the SEC, and it is the Trust’s understanding that any recoveries obtained by the SEC will be transmitted to the Trust pursuant to a
Fair Fund established by the SEC.
|
o |
Actions regarding the Shapiro’s personal assets. On December 4, 2019, the Trust filed an action in the Bankruptcy Court, Adv. Pro. No. 10-51076 (BLS), Woodbridge Liquidation Trust v. Robert Shapiro, Jeri Shapiro, 3X a Charm, LLC, Carbondale Basalt Owners, LLC, Davana Sherman Oaks Owners, LLC, In Trend Staging, LLC, Midland Loop Enterprises, LLC, Schwartz
Media Buying Company, LLC and Stover Real Estate Partners LLC. In this action, the Trust asserts claims under chapter 5 of the Bankruptcy Code and applicable state law for avoidance of preferential and fraudulent transfers
together with claims for fraud, aiding and abetting fraud, the unlicensed sale of securities, breach of fiduciary duty and unjust enrichment. The Trust seeks to recover damages and assets held in the names of Robert Shapiro, Jeri Shapiro
and their family members and entities owned or controlled by them, which assets the Trust contends are beneficially owned by the Debtors or for which the Debtors are entitled to recover based on the Shapiros’ defalcations, including over
$20 million in avoidable transfers. On February 4, 2022, the Trust entered into a Settlement Agreement with Ms. Jeri Shapiro resolving the Trust’s adversary proceeding against Ms. Shapiro. In connection with the Settlement Agreement, Ms.
Shapiro responded to interrogatories from the Trust and submitted a declaration under penalty of perjury detailing her lack of assets. Upon execution of the Settlement Agreement, Ms. Shapiro executed and delivered a Stipulated Judgment
for approximately $20.6 million that will be held by the Trust in escrow for three years that can be entered without notice if the Trust learns Ms. Shapiro’s representations in her declaration were false or materially inaccurate.
Additionally, Ms. Shapiro authorized the Trust to expunge the filed claims of certain co-defendants she was listed as an officer and turned over payments to the Trust that were received by certain co-defendants in the adversary
proceeding. A stipulation of dismissal (as to Ms. Shapiro only) was entered on April 1, 2022.
|
o |
Criminal proceeding and forfeiture. In connection with the United States’ criminal case against Robert Shapiro (Case No. No. 19-20178-CR-ALTONAGA (S.D. Fla. 2019)),
Shapiro agreed to the forfeiture of certain assets. The Trust filed a petition in the Florida court to claim the Forfeited Assets as property of the Debtors’ estates, and therefore as property that had vested in the Trust pursuant to the
Plan. The Trust has entered into an agreement with the United States Department of Justice to resolve its claim. The agreement was approved by the Bankruptcy Court on September 17, 2020 and was approved by the United States District
Court on October 1, 2020. Among other things, the agreement provides for the release of specified Forfeited Assets by the United States to the Trust, and for the Trust to liquidate those assets and distribute the net sale proceeds to
Qualifying Victims, which include the vast majority of Trust beneficiaries—specifically, all former holders of Class 3 and 5 claims under the Plan and their permitted assigns—but do not include former holders of Class 4 claims under the
Plan. The Trust has taken possession of the Forfeited Assets and has sold the wine and gold assets as well as an automobile. Some of the jewelry, art, clothing, handbags and shoes have also been sold.
